About Zenonas Rudzikas

Zenonas Rudzikas is a scholar working on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Surfaces, Coatings and Films and Instrumentation, having authored 38 papers that have together received 405 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Atomic and Molecular Physics (22 papers),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(16 papers) and Electron and X-Ray Spectroscopy Techniques (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(345 citations), Nuclear and High Energy Physics (88 citations) and Spectroscopy (93 citations). Zenonas Rudzikas has collaborated with scholars based in Lithuania, Russia and China. Frequent co-authors include Gediminas Gaigalas, P. Bogdanovich, M. S. Safronova, U. I. Safronova, S. Fritzsche, R. Kisielius, Marius J. Vilkas, K. Blagoev, L. J. Curtis and David Ellis. Their work appears in journals such as Monthly Notices of the Royal Astronomical Society, Physical Review A and Atomic Data and Nuclear Data Tables.
